YEREVAN, MARCH 15, ARMENPRESS. Armenia is in favor of all states and organizations of the world cooperating with Turkey. In this case Turkey might perhaps become more predictable, President Sargsyan said in Moscow’s State Institute of International Relations, in response to a students’ question on the latest developments in the Russian-Turkish relations, Armenpress correspondent reported.
“We don’t have hatred towards the Turkish people. We accuse the Turkish leadership in denying the Genocide, and the denial of the Genocide is the continuation of that crime against humanity”, the President said. He reminded that Russia has recognized the Armenian Genocide, for which Armenia is grateful to Russia.
“Therefore, the Russian-Turkish relations don’t bother us too much. The fact that there were several articles, perhaps special articles, that people began to make hand movements in Armenia when the Turks shot down the Russian plane, as if we were glad, however in reality that isn’t so. During our entire history we had problems when big powers clashed. Secondly, no war is justified, no clash brings any good. The only justified war is when you are forced to defend yourself, for example in the case of Nagorno Karabakh – no one there wanted war, however neither did they want to die. I think the better the Russian-Turkish relations are, the better it is for us”, he said.
